Types and Timing of Maintenance
To use this machine under its optimal conditions, it is important to perform the appropriate maintenance at the appropriate times.
Regular Maintenance
These are the maintenance items that are required on a daily basis.
Timing | Category | Item |
---|---|---|
Before daily operations | Cleaning of the print heads | Printing Tests and Normal Cleaning |
During and after daily operations | Cleaning the Machine | Cleaning the Machine |
Cleaning of the print heads | Removing Excess Ink Adhering to the Print Heads | |
Cleaning of the print heads | Stabilizing Ink Discharge | |
Filling with Ink | Filling with Ink | |
When the discharged fluid is ready to overflow | Disposing of discharged fluid | If the Discharged Fluid Disposal Message Appears |
Once a week | Cleaning of the print heads | Manual Cleaning Method |
When dot drop-out or dot displacement occurs | Cleaning of the print heads | Printing Tests and Normal Cleaning |
Medium Cleaning Method | ||
Powerful Cleaning Method | ||
Manual Cleaning Method | ||
Once a month | Cleaning the UV-LED devices | Cleaning That Must Be Performed Once a Month or More |
Replacing Consumable Parts
Perform replacement of consumable parts at appropriate times.
For information about replacing consumable parts, contact your authorized dealer.
Timing | Part name |
---|---|
Every six months | Wiper |
Every six months | Cap Top |
